Seatbelts don’t prevent car crashes. They prevent you from flying through the windshield if a crash occurs, reducing likelihood of death & serious injuries. Umbrellas don’t always prevent you from getting wet, but they prevent you from being drenched in a storm: that’s their job. 5/

Vaccines are no different; just like seatbelts, airbags, and other medications, they are risk mitigation measures that we know are effective. But we know NONE of these things are always effective. Vaccines must be viewed the same. Read more: news.immunologic.org/p/moving-the... 🧵
